Brake Pedal - Vehicles With: Automatic Transmission


Brake Pedal - Vehicles With: Automatic Transmission

Service Repair No - 70.35.01


Removal
1. Remove the headlamp switch.
2. Remove the stoplamp switch.
3. Remove the instrument panel access panel.
^ Release the 2 clips





4. Remove the brake pedal bracket.
^ Release the wiring harness clip
^ Remove the 4 Torx bolts





5. Remove the brake pedal clevis pin.
^ Remove the clip





6. Remove the brake pedal.
^ Remove the nut and bolt





NOTE: Do not diassemble further if component is removed for access only

7. Remove the brake pedal pad.





Installation
1. Install the brake pedal pad.
2. Install the brake pedal.
^ Clean the component mating faces
^ Tighten the nut and bolt to 45 Nm (33 ft. lbs.)
3. Install the brake pedal clevis pin.
^ Install the clip
4. Install the brake pedal bracket
^ Tighten the Torx bolts to 10 Nm (7 ft. lbs.)
^ Secure the wiring harness
5. Install the instrument panel access panel.
^ Secure with clips
6. Install the stoplamp switch.
7. Install the headlamp switch.
